When you add up all these led's you are talking a wee bit of juice.\n\nhttp://learn.adafruit.com/rgb-led-strips/current-draw has some nice pointers that boils down to this:\n\n*  60mA x 10 (ten segments per meter for the 30/LED per meter strip) = 0.6 Amps per meter\n\nThis means on our 10A power supply we get (10/0.6) 16.6 meters (55 feet or so) before we go out of spec for the power supply.\n\nAt 30/LED per meter, we end up with 16.6*30 or roughly 500 LEDs at FULL brightness.  Any sort of pattern or dimming can extend \nthis pretty effectively, half power should be good for 1000 LEDs.  Our four strips are 5 meters each, or 20 meters and 600 LEDs.\n\nTo make things safe at full power, we need to drop 4 meters, or 1 meter per strip and we should be ok.\n\nShort of using a computer PSU, this is is folks.\n\nparts (overall)\n===============\n* 1x adafruit minty (arduino in a can).\n* 1x 5v 10amp ps\n\nrough cost: $60\n\nparts (channel)\n===============\n* 1x 6\" rgb cable \n* 1x rgb cabel-\u003efour pin connector\n* 3x N-channel power mosfet\n* 1x 74HC595 shift register\n\nrough cost per channel: $7 ($28 for all 4)\n\nTotal cost is roughly $88 sourced from adafruit. \n","project_url":"https://awesome.ecosyste.ms/api/v1/projects/github.com%2Ferniebrodeur%2Farduino_led_controller","html_url":"https://awesome.ecosyste.ms/projects/github.com%2Ferniebrodeur%2Farduino_led_controller","lists_url":"https://awesome.ecosyste.ms/api/v1/projects/github.com%2Ferniebrodeur%2Farduino_led_controller/lists"}
